Scottish aviation software developer AvioNexus is showcasing Version 3.0 of its flight management platform at Air Charter Expo 2026 at London Biggin Hill Airport on September 8.
The platform is designed to eliminate the need for operators, brokers and FBOs to share passport details, passenger manifests and other sensitive information via email or messaging apps, instead handling all communication within a single secure system. AvioNexus said the approach reduces GDPR risks while giving FBOs real-time visibility of flight activity and confirmed passenger details.
“Passenger data privacy is something every operator, FBO and brokerage needs to prioritize,” said Andrew Douglas, founder and CEO of AvioNexus. “We know from our own experiences over the years we can make their busy work lives much easier.”
AvioNexus was launched in 2019 by a team of aviation specialists, designers and software developers in Scotland.
